Vitc、Vite对DEHP致果蝇脂质过氧化的拮抗作用

摘    要:目的:探讨酞酸酯类化合物作用于果蝇引起组织中脂质过氧化产物增多的作用和机理。同时探讨VitC、VitE对这种作用的拮抗。方法:测定不同浓度邻苯二甲酸一2—乙基己基酯(DEHP)染毒组果蝇体内超氧化物歧化薛(SOD)活性和丙二醛(MDA)含量;再检测同时给予较高剂量DEHP和不同浓度的VitC和VitE的情况下,果蝇体内SOD活性和MDA含量。结果:喂以DEHP的雌、雄果蝇体内SOD活性明显降低(P<0.05),MDA含量明显升高(P<0.05);同时喂饲DEHP和VitC、VitE可使SOD活性升高,MDA含量降低。结论:DEHP可引发果蝇体内脂质过氧化作用,而VitC和VitE对这种影响有拮抗作用。

Antagonism of VitC and VitE on Lipid Peroxidation in Drosophila Melanogaster Treated with DEHP

Abstract:Objective To observe the effect of di- phthalate on lipid peroxidation in drosophila and the antagonism of VitC and VitE against this effect.Methods The changes of SOD and MDA in drosophila given different doses of DEHP were detected. Then, the activity of SOD and the content of MDA in drosophila given high dose of DEHP and different doses of VitC and VitE were examined simultaneously.Results SOD activity in tissue dramatically decreased and MDA content significantly increased with the increase of DEHP.Meanwhile,the simultaneous administration of VitC and VitE can increase the activity of SOD and decrease the content of MDA in drosophila.Conclusion DEHP can significantly increase lipid peroxidation in drosophla and antioxidant vitamins can protect drosophila from DEHP- toxicity.
